 #52

next few years what Bhutan and El Salvador are doing now will have a big impact on their countries and large countries will realize that they are lagging behind Bhutan and El Salvador.

Even I was surprised, they didn't write much in the media. Bhutan, I think thinking ahead, sees Bitcoin as a promising investment to help the country's economic development. In fact, I just read that Bhutan is the 4th largest BTC depositor. Uniquely, it was not obtained from confiscation but mining. In fact, it seems that the government is deliberately building a crypto mining factory. It seems that if there is no investigation this news will not come out.  Amazingly, the number of crypto assets owned by Bhutan is 26.9% of the national gross domestic product (GDP) in 2023.

September 25, 2024, 10:27:55 PM
 #57

Such a small country jumping into Bitcoin is interesting, and a good news. It really underlined the strategic shift toward holding $828 million in Bitcoin, mainly from their mining operations. That wasn't due to seizures of the assets, as some governments do, but large-scale mining that really ramped up in early 2023. By using Bitcoin, Bhutan should be able to broaden its traditionally single-industry economy, which depends on hydropower. Their strategy could easily become a model for other small nations willing to enter the crypto world.

how they get cheap electricity ? They've no nuclear power plants afaik? They are using the energy of their water falls? Or they use something else to leverage their altitude in the Himalayan mountains? I guess they are able to produce hydroelectricity at a cheap price during spring and other seasons but what are they doing during winter when the water becomes ice and snow?

It says that they are utilizing their hydropower and also government's assistance. On this regard, they are exhausting their renewable sources to cater the need of its people. Also, they have excess energy produced, so they are selling the extra to countries like India. And of course, with such revenue, it can further contribute to the government's financial needs.
